Hopefully you will get a sense of some of the power of R this semester. R is becoming the primary language of statistics and is being adopted across academia, government, and businesses to help manage and learn from the growing volume of data being obtained. This means that the skills you learn now can follow you the rest of your life. They are open source and free to download and use (and will always be that way). You will need to download the statistical software package called R and an enhanced interface to R called R-studio (Rstudio, 2014).
This book and access to a computer (PC, Mac, or just computer lab computers on campus) are the only required materials for the course.
